संसाधन: DebugToken
डीबग टोकन किसी ऐप्लिकेशन को डेवलप करने या उसके इंटिग्रेशन के लिए टेस्टिंग के दौरान इस्तेमाल किया जाने वाला सीक्रेट टोकन है. इसका इस्तेमाल करके डेवलपमेंट या इंटिग्रेशन टेस्टिंग के लिए ऐप्लिकेशन की पुष्टि की प्रक्रिया को बायपास किया जा सकता है. साथ ही, इससे ऐप्लिकेशन की जांच करने की सुविधा के ज़रिए, Firebase की उन सेवाओं के लिए सुरक्षा लागू की जा सकती है जो इसके साथ काम करती हैं.
जेएसओएन के काेड में दिखाना |
---|
{ "name": string, "displayName": string, "token": string } |
फ़ील्ड | |
---|---|
name |
ज़रूरी है. डीबग टोकन के रिलेटिव रिसॉर्स का नाम, फ़ॉर्मैट में:
|
displayName |
ज़रूरी है. इस डीबग टोकन की पहचान करने के लिए, इस्तेमाल किया जाने वाला डिसप्ले नेम, जिसे कोई भी व्यक्ति आसानी से पढ़ सकता है. |
token |
ज़रूरी है. सिर्फ़ इनपुट. इम्यूटेबल. खुद सीक्रेट टोकन. बनाते समय दिया जाना चाहिए. साथ ही, यह UUID4, केस-इनसेंसिटिव होना चाहिए. इस फ़ील्ड को एक बार सेट नहीं किया जा सकता. इसे सुरक्षा से जुड़ी वजहों से, इस फ़ील्ड को किसी भी जवाब में कभी भी अपने-आप नहीं भरा जाएगा. |
तरीके |
|
---|---|
|
बताए गए ऐप्लिकेशन के लिए नया DebugToken बनाता है. |
|
बताए गए DebugToken को मिटाता है. |
|
बताए गए DebugToken देता है. |
|
बताए गए ऐप्लिकेशन के लिए सभी DebugToken की सूची बनाता है. |
|
बताए गए DebugToken को अपडेट करता है. |